
EcoLiteracy
EcoLiteracy is the knowledge and understanding of how natural ecosystems function and how human actions impact the environment. It involves recognizing the connections between natural resources, ecosystems, and human well-being, enabling individuals to make informed decisions that promote sustainability. Being eco-literate helps people appreciate the importance of preserving biodiversity, reducing waste, conserving energy, and supporting practices that protect the planet for current and future generations. Essentially, it’s about having the awareness and skills to live and work in ways that minimize environmental harm and foster a healthier, more sustainable world.
